Runway 09 at KMEM is the eastbound end at FREDERICK W SMITH INTL/MEMPHIS in Memphis, Tennessee. The opposite end is Runway 27. Runway 09 has a magnetic heading of 92°. It is 8,946 ft long and 150 ft wide. Surface is concrete. Pattern direction is left traffic. This end has an ILS. The localizer is 109.5 with a course of 92.95° magnetic. Field elevation at KMEM is 340.9 ft MSL. Threshold elevation for Runway 09 is 253.2 ft MSL. Check the current FAA Chart Supplement for NOTAM and runway condition before departure.
